Noel Du Fail: conteur. By MARIE-CLAIRE BICHARD-THOMINE. Paris: Champion. 2001. 627 pp. 89.95 [euro]. ISBN 2-7453-05271-1.
Hitherto, Du Fail has received rather limited scholarly attention. Lack of modern editions may have deterred interest; equally discouraging, perhaps, has been the view that he was a slavish imitator of Rabelais (a 'singe', according to Etienne Pasquier). This book, which is based on a doctoral thesis, is therefore particularly welcome....
